メインコンテンツまでスキップ

Apple Walletの設定方法

このページでは、Apple Wallet を設定し、お客様がストアの会員証(バーコード・QRコード)をApple Walletに登録する方法を案内します。

Apple Walletに会員証を登録することで、お客様はロック画面からすぐにバーコード・QRコードを表示できるため、ストアにログインをするという手間を省くことで、よりスムーズな購買体験を提供いただけます。


前提条件

本機能のご利用にはApple Developer Program の登録が必要です。 登録には以下の2つの項目が必須となっております。

  • 二要素認証が有効になっている Apple ID
  • D-U-N-S番号(法人名義でのお申込みの場合)

登録の詳細についてはプログラムへの登録をご参照ください。Apple Developer Programには年間登録料(99USD~)が発生します。

Apple Walletが設置できるテーマ

  • お客様アカウントがお客様アカウント(おすすめ)
  • お客様アカウントが以前のバージョンでOS2.0対応テーマ

Apple Walletが設置できないテーマ

  • お客様アカウントが以前のバージョンでOS2.0非対応のテーマ

Apple Walletの設定方法 - 共通部分

Barcodeatorアプリで Apple Wallet のタブを開きます。

1. フィールド入力および画像のアップロード

  • カードタイトル
  • バーコードタイプ(QRコード or CODE128)
  • 画像(ロゴ、アイコン、メイン画像) × 3サイズ

上記を設定します。Apple Walletに設定項目がどのように反映されるかは、ページ右側のイメージを参照ください。

Apple Wallet 画像アップロード画面

画像アップロード後、Apple Wallet保存のボタンを押して、画像を保存します。

2. CSR(証明書署名要求ファイル)のダウンロード

画像のアップロードが完了すると、Appleの証明書発行に必要なCSRファイル(証明書署名要求ファイル) をダウンロードできます。

CSRは、次の手順でApple Developerの管理画面で証明書を発行する際に使用します。

画像アップロード後の画面


Apple Developerで証明書(pass.cer)を発行する手順

以下はApple公式のDeveloper管理画面で行う証明書発行のステップです。

1. Apple Developerにログイン

Certificates/証明書のリンクをクリックしましょう。

Apple Developer ホーム

2. Identifiersを開き、新しいIdentifierを作成

Identifiersの横にある+のボタンをクリックしてください。

Register an App ID

3. Pass Type ID を選択

Register a new identifierでPass Type IDsを選択し、Continueボタンをクリックしましょう。

Register a New Identifier

Description、Identifierに適した情報を入力します。Descriptionはストア名 Pass Type ID Identifierは pass.com.myshopify.ストア名 のような形式で記入すると、区別がつきやすいです。

Pass Type ID 選択

Registerをクリックして登録を完了しましょう。

Pass Type ID 情報入力

4. Identifiers一覧から該当Pass Type IDを開く

手順3で作成した、Pass Type IDsをIdentifiers一覧からクリックします。

Identifiers Home

5. 証明書を作成(Create Certificate)

Create Certificateボタンをクリックして、証明書作成に進みます。

Create Certificate

Choose Fileをクリックして、Barcodeatorアプリからダウンロードした CSRファイル をアップロードしてください。

※ Enter your Pass certificate Nameの欄は空白でも構いません。

新しい証明書作成

CSRファイルをアップロードすると、Continueボタンかクリック可能となります。Continueのボタンを押し、登録を完了させてください。

6. Certificate(pass.cer)のダウンロード

5までの手順が完了すると、Apple側で pass.cer が生成されます。

Downloadボタンを押して、pass.cer ファイルを任意の場所に保存してください。

証明書ダウンロード

Apple Developerの管理画面での操作は以上で完了です。


Apple Walletの設定方法 - Barcodeatorにpass.cerをアップロード

Apple Developerで発行された pass.cer を Barcodeatorアプリに戻ってアップロードします。

証明書アップロードのエリアをクリックまたは、ドラッグ&ドロップで対象の場所にpass.cerファイルを反映してください。

pass.cerアップロード画面

アップロードが完了すると以下のような状態になります。

pass.cerアップロード完了

⚠️ 証明書は約1年で失効します。毎年更新対応が必要となりますので、更新忘れにご注意ください。


Apple Walletの設置方法

お客様アカウント(おすすめ)

Apple Walletはプロフィールページにアプリブロックとして表示できます。

  • Barcodeatorアプリのホーム画面で「プロフィールページを編集」
    または
  • Shopify管理画面 → 設定 → チェックアウト → カスタマイズ

左メニューの アプリ から Add to Apple Wallet を選択し、追加先で プロフィール を選択します。

お客様アカウント(おすすめ)での表示例

以前のバージョンかつOS2.0対応テーマ

  • Shopify管理画面 → 販売チャネル → オンラインストア → テーマ → カスタマイズ

表示された画面で セクション追加 > アプリ > Add to Apple Wallet をクリックし追加します。

以前のアカウントでの表示例

⚠️ カスタマイズ画面ではダミーデータしか表示されません。
実際の動作確認はiPhoneのブラウジングからログインした状態で 行ってください。


Apple Wallet設定が未完了の場合のエラー

Apple Walletの設定が正常に完了していない場合、アプリブロック追加時に以下の警告が表示されます。

お客様アカウント(おすすめ)の例

Apple Wallet設定エラー(新UI)

以前のバージョンのアカウントの例

Apple Wallet設定エラー(レガシー)

⚠️ エラーが表示された場合、
Apple Walletの設定方法 - 共通部分の内容(画像・CSRアップロード・pass.cerアップロード)を再確認してください。


以上で、Apple Walletの設定は完了です。
続いて、Shopify POSでBarcodeatorを使用するにお進みください。